How do you check a snowmobile fuel pump?

Testing your snowmobile fuel pump: Remove the tubing connecting the fuel tank to the fuel tank inlet on the fuel pump. Attach the vacuum gauge to the fuel tank inlet. Crank your engine. Check the gauge to see if a vacuum is reported when the engine is cranked.

What should I do if my fuel pump won’t Prime?

On a fuel injected bike with the key ON, you should hear the fuel pump momentarily prime (high-pitched whine) once the run switch is positioned ON. If the pump fails to prime, check for a blown fuel pump fuse in the fuse box. If the fuse is good, inspect the fuel pump electrical harness plug. Figure 8. Fuel pump harness plug under tank console.

Why does my Dyna Glide not start up?

Surprisingly, a faulty fuel gauge has caught numerous owners off-guard, and upon refilling the tank, the bike has started right up. If your bike is a carbureted model and you are not getting any fuel, chances are the carb is gummed up and the jets are not flowing any fuel. A quick disassembly and cleaning is often an easy fix. Where is the starter relay on a Dyna Glide?

Starter solenoid electrical connections. Another component to inspect is the starter relay, which is located in the electrical fuse box underneath the side cover on the left side of the motorcycle. Relays have the potential to go bad and prevent high current from reaching the starter.
